Professional Editing
Once the rough manuscript and any ghostwritten content is complete, the editing phase begins. This consists of:
• Developmental editing: Ensures your content structure and themes are strong.
• Copy editing: Focuses on grammar, clarity and consistency.
• Proofreading: Final error‑checking before design.
Investing in professional editing is one of the most critical steps on this checklist. Many authors see a dramatic improvement in quality after this stage, ensuring the final book reflects a professional standard.

Planning for Publishing
At this stage, you choose the path you wish to follow:
1. Traditional Publishing
Traditional publishing involves submitting to established publishers, often through literary agents. This path can be competitive but offers support in editing, marketing and distribution. Legal and Administrative Requirements
Publishing involves regulatory steps:
• ISBN acquisition.
• Legal deposit submissions to national libraries.
• Copyright registration.
A reputable publisher will help you navigate these requirements smoothly, avoiding delays or compliance issues.
